OXON HILL, Maryland. (WIAT) – Dr. Ben Carson announced he is officially suspending his campaign during his CPAC speech in Maryland.

After Super Tuesday, Carson released a statement saying he sees “no path forward” to the nomination. He then declined to attend Thursday’s GOP debate in Michigan.

Monday, Carson spoke to CBS42 in Montgomery, Ala. during a campaign stop at Auburn University at Montgomery.

He talked to CBS42’s Jamie Ostroff, calling the Republican race a “personality contest” that so far had not been fair to him.

Carson did not attend Thursday night’s debate.
